Frequently Asked Questions

Is Poland or Sweden cheaper to live in?

Poland has a cost of living index of 42.3 compared to Sweden's 59.7 (NYC = 100). That makes Poland roughly 29% more affordable for everyday expenses including rent.

Which has easier immigration, Poland or Sweden?

Poland offers 5 non-tourist visa pathways while Sweden offers 7. Average processing time is 8 weeks for Poland and 19 weeks for Sweden.

Do I need to speak the local language to get residency in Poland or Sweden?

Poland requires B1 Polish for permanent residency. Sweden requires None required. Language proficiency can also affect your citizenship timeline.

How long does it take to get permanent residency in Poland vs Sweden?

Poland requires 5 years of continuous residence for PR. Sweden requires 5 years. Both timelines start from the date your first residence permit is issued.

What are salaries like in Poland compared to Sweden?

The median skilled worker salary is €20,000 per year in Poland and €44,000 per year in Sweden. Cost of living differences mean purchasing power varies significantly.

Can I work remotely in Poland or Sweden?

Poland does not have a dedicated digital nomad visa. Sweden does not have a dedicated digital nomad visa.
